Police Constable Degree Apprenticeship (PCDA)

✘ If you don’t have a degree
A 3-year programme where you’ll train to become a uniformed officer and gain a fully funded degree

Read More

Police Constable Entry Programme (PCEP)

✘ If you don’t have a degree
A 2-year programme that doesn’t require you to study for a degree during your training

Read More

Degree Holder Entry Programme (DHEP)

✔ If you have a degree
A 2-year programme for degree holders allowing you to qualify as a uniformed officer

Read More

Graduate Detective Programme (GDP)

✔ If you have a degree
A 2-year programme for degree holders where you’ll train to become a detective

Before you apply to become a detective through our graduate programme, or a police officer through our degree holder programme, degree apprenticeship or police constable entry programme you’ll need to join a mandatory virtual information event.

Here, you’ll gain insight into what working as a detective or uniformed police officer at Northumbria Police is really like, find out more about the application process and how to prepare for the roleeligibility requirements, police officer pay & benefits, and you’ll have the opportunity to speak to current officers about life at #teamnp.

Once you have signed up and registered your interest, we will be in touch with an email inviting you to book on to a information event of your preferred date and time.
